Шаблон:Native — различия между версиями
Материал из GTAModding.ru
Seemann (обсуждение | вклад) (Новая: <table cellspacing="4" cellpadding="2" style="border: 1px solid #cedff2; text-align: left; line-height: 1.5em; margin: .5em 0 .5em 1em">{{#ifexpr: {{{noheader|0}}}=1||<caption>'''{{PAGEN...) |
Seemann (обсуждение | вклад) |
||
Строка 1: | Строка 1: | ||
− | <table cellspacing="4" cellpadding="2" style="border: 1px solid #cedff2; text-align: left; line-height: 1.5em; margin: .5em 0 .5em 1em">{{#ifexpr: {{{noheader|0}}}=1||<caption>'''{{PAGENAMEE}}'''</caption>}}<tr><th colspan="3" align="center">Число параметров: {{{np}}}</th></tr>{{#ifexpr: {{{{{{np}}}|0}}}>0 | <tr><th>#</th><th>Тип</th><th>Описание</th></tr>}} | + | <includeonly><table cellspacing="4" cellpadding="2" style="border: 1px solid #cedff2; text-align: left; line-height: 1.5em; margin: .5em 0 .5em 1em">{{#ifexpr: {{{noheader|0}}}=1||<caption>'''{{PAGENAMEE}}'''</caption>}}<tr><th colspan="3" align="center">Число параметров: {{{np}}}</th></tr>{{#ifexpr: {{{{{{np}}}|0}}}>0 | <tr><th>#</th><th>Тип</th><th>Описание</th></tr>}} |
− | {{#if: {{{p1t|}}}|<tr><td>Параметр 1</td>{{#if: {{{p1t|}}}|<td>{{{p1t}}}</td>|<td></td>}}{{#if: {{{p1d|}}}|<td>{{{p1d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p2t|}}}|<tr><td>Параметр 2</td>{{#if: {{{p2t|}}}|<td>{{{p2t}}}</td>|<td></td>}} | + | {{#if: {{{p1t|}}}|<tr><td>Параметр 1</td>{{#if: {{{p1t|}}}|<td>{{{p1t}}}</td>|<td></td>}}{{#if: {{{p1d|}}}|<td>{{{p1d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p2t|}}}|<tr><td>Параметр 2</td>{{#if: {{{p2t|}}}|<td>{{{p2t}}}</td>|<td></td>}}{{#if: {{{p2d|}}}|<td>{{{p2d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p3t|}}}|<tr><td>Параметр 3</td>{{#if: {{{p3t|}}}|<td>{{{p3t}}}</td>|<td></td>}}{{#if: {{{p3d|}}}|<td>{{{p3d|}}}</td>|td></td>}}</tr>}}{{#if: {{{p4t|}}}|<tr><td>Параметр 4</td>{{#if: {{{p4t|}}}|<td>{{{p4t}}}</td>|<td></td>}}{{#if: {{{p4d|}}}|<td>{{{p4d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p5t|}}}|<tr><td>Параметр 5</td>{{#if: {{{p5t|}}}|<td>{{{p5t}}}</td>|<td></td>}} |
− | {{#if: {{{p2d|}}}|<td>{{{p2d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p3t|}}}|<tr><td>Параметр 3</td>{{#if: {{{p3t|}}}|<td>{{{p3t}}}</td>|<td></td>}} | + | {{#if: {{{p5d|}}}|<td>{{{p5d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p6t|}}}|<tr><td>Параметр 6</td>{{#if: {{{p6t|}}}|<td>{{{p6t}}}</td>|<td></td>}}{{#if: {{{p6d|}}}|<td>{{{p6d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p7t|}}}|<tr><td>Параметр 7</td>{{#if: {{{p7t|}}}|<td>{{{p7t}}}</td>|<td></td>}}{{#if: {{{p7d|}}}|<td>{{{p7d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p8t|}}}|<tr><td>Параметр 8</td>{{#if: {{{p8t|}}}|<td>{{{p8t}}}</td>|<td></td>}}{{#if: {{{p8d|}}}|<td>{{{p8d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p9t|}}}|<tr><td>Параметр 9</td>{{#if: {{{p9t|}}}|<td>{{{p9t}}}</td>|<td></td>}}{{#if: {{{p9d|}}}|<td>{{{p9d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p10t|}}}|<tr><td>Параметр 10</td>{{#if: {{{p10t|}}}|<td>{{{p10t}}}</td>|<td></td>}}{{#if: {{{p10d|}}}|<td>{{{p10d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p11t|}}}|<tr><td>Параметр 11</td>{{#if: {{{p11t|}}}|<td>{{{p11t}}}</td>|<td></td>}}{{#if: {{{p11d|}}}|<td>{{{p11d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p12t|}}}|<tr><td>Параметр 12</td>{{#if: {{{p12t|}}}|<td>{{{p12t}}}</td>|<td></td>}}{{#if: {{{p12d|}}}|<td>{{{p12d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p13t|}}}|<tr><td>Параметр 13</td>{{#if: {{{p13t|}}}|<td>{{{p13t}}}</td>|<td></td>}}{{#if: {{{p13d|}}}|<td>{{{p13d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p14t|}}}|<tr><td>Параметр 14</td>{{#if: {{{p14t|}}}|<td>{{{p14t}}}</td>|<td></td>}}{{#if: {{{p14d|}}}|<td>{{{p14d|}}}</td>|<td></td>}}</tr>}} |
− | {{#if: {{{p3d|}}}|<td>{{{p3d|}}}</td>|td></td>}}</tr>}}{{#if: {{{p4t|}}}|<tr><td>Параметр 4</td>{{#if: {{{p4t|}}}|<td>{{{p4t}}}</td>|<td></td>}} | + | {{#if: {{{p15t|}}}|<tr><td>Параметр 15</td>{{#if: {{{p15t|}}}|<td>{{{p15t}}}</td>|<td></td>}}{{#if: {{{p15d|}}}|<td>{{{p15d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p16t|}}}|<tr><td>Параметр 16</td>{{#if: {{{p16t|}}}|<td>{{{p16t}}}</td>|<td></td>}}{{#if: {{{p16d|}}}|<td>{{{p16d|}}}</td>|<td></td>}}</tr>}}<tr><th colspan="3" align="center">Результат функции:</th></tr><tr><th>Есть?</th><th>Тип</th><th>Описание</th></tr><tr>{{#ifexpr: {{{r|0}}}=1 | <td>Да</td> | <td colspan="3">Нет</td>}}{{#if: {{{rt|}}}|<td>{{{rt}}}</td>|<td></td>}}{{#if: {{{rd|}}}|<td>{{{rd}}}</td>|<td></td>}}</tr></table></includeonly> |
− | {{#if: {{{p4d|}}}|<td>{{{p4d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p5t|}}}|<tr><td>Параметр 5</td>{{#if: {{{p5t|}}}|<td>{{{p5t}}}</td>|<td></td>}} | + | <noinclude>Шаблон для описание скриптовых функций [[GTA 4]]<pre> |
− | {{#if: {{{p5d|}}}|<td>{{{p5d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p6t|}}}|<tr><td>Параметр 6</td>{{#if: {{{p6t|}}}|<td>{{{p6t}}}</td>|<td></td>}} | + | |
− | {{#if: {{{p6d|}}}|<td>{{{p6d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p7t|}}}|<tr><td>Параметр 7</td>{{#if: {{{p7t|}}}|<td>{{{p7t}}}</td>|<td></td>}}{{#if: {{{p7d|}}}|<td>{{{p7d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p8t|}}}|<tr><td>Параметр 8</td>{{#if: {{{p8t|}}}|<td>{{{p8t}}}</td>|<td></td>}}{{#if: {{{p8d|}}}|<td>{{{p8d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p9t|}}}|<tr><td>Параметр 9</td>{{#if: {{{p9t|}}}|<td>{{{p9t}}}</td>|<td></td>}}{{#if: {{{p9d|}}}|<td>{{{p9d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p10t|}}}|<tr><td>Параметр 10</td>{{#if: {{{p10t|}}}|<td>{{{p10t}}}</td>|<td></td>}}{{#if: {{{p10d|}}}|<td>{{{p10d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p11t|}}}|<tr><td>Параметр 11</td>{{#if: {{{p11t|}}}|<td>{{{p11t}}}</td>|<td></td>}}{{#if: {{{p11d|}}}|<td>{{{p11d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p12t|}}}|<tr><td>Параметр 12</td>{{#if: {{{p12t|}}}|<td>{{{p12t}}}</td>|<td></td>}}{{#if: {{{p12d|}}}|<td>{{{p12d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p13t|}}}|<tr><td>Параметр 13</td>{{#if: {{{p13t|}}}|<td>{{{p13t}}}</td>|<td></td>}}{{#if: {{{p13d|}}}|<td>{{{p13d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p14t|}}}|<tr><td>Параметр 14</td>{{#if: {{{p14t|}}}|<td>{{{p14t}}}</td>|<td></td>}}{{#if: {{{p14d|}}}|<td>{{{p14d|}}}</td>|<td></td>}}</tr>}} | + | |
− | {{#if: {{{p15t|}}}|<tr><td>Параметр 15</td>{{#if: {{{p15t|}}}|<td>{{{p15t}}}</td>|<td></td>}}{{#if: {{{p15d|}}}|<td>{{{p15d|}}}</td>|<td></td>}}</tr>}}{{#if: {{{p16t|}}}|<tr><td>Параметр 16</td>{{#if: {{{p16t|}}}|<td>{{{p16t}}}</td>|<td></td>}}{{#if: {{{p16d|}}}|<td>{{{p16d|}}}</td>|<td></td>}}</tr>}}<tr><th colspan="3" align="center">Результат функции:</th></tr><tr><th>Есть?</th><th>Тип</th><th>Описание</th></tr><tr>{{#ifexpr: {{{r|0}}}=1 | <td>Да</td> | <td colspan="3">Нет</td>}}{{#if: {{{rt|}}}|<td>{{{rt}}}</td>|<td></td>}}{{#if: {{{rd|}}}|<td>{{{rd}}}</td>|<td></td>}}</tr></table> | + | |
− | <noinclude><pre> | + | |
{{Native | {{Native | ||
|noheader = <используйте 1, если вы не хотите, чтобы у таблицы был заголовок> | |noheader = <используйте 1, если вы не хотите, чтобы у таблицы был заголовок> |
Текущая версия на 15:50, 18 февраля 2009
Шаблон для описание скриптовых функций GTA 4{{Native |noheader = <используйте 1, если вы не хотите, чтобы у таблицы был заголовок> |np = <число параметров функции> |p1t = <типа параметра 1 (integer, float, pointer, handle, boolean) |p1d = <описание параметра 1 |p2t = <тип параметра 2 (integer, float, pointer, handle, boolean) |p2d = <описание параметра 2 |<другие параметры, если они есть> |r = <поставьте 1, если функция возвращает значение, иначе 0> |rt = <тип результата функции> |rd = <описание результата функции> }}